IRC logs for #aegir, 2016-05-03 (GMT)

2016-05-02
2016-05-04
TimeNickMessage
[10:44:42]* mstenta has quit (Ping timeout: 246 seconds)
[10:56:06]* rominronin has joined #aegir
[11:00:33]* rominronin has quit (Ping timeout: 240 seconds)
[11:28:45]* Egyptian[Home] has joined #aegir
[11:37:11]* zombiebeard has joined #aegir
[11:50:54]* Yaazkal has joined #aegir
[12:06:04]* Yaazkal has quit ()
[12:16:17]* nulp_ has joined #aegir
[12:18:51]* nulp has quit (Ping timeout: 246 seconds)
[12:20:59]* cmoates has quit (Quit: ZNC - http://znc.in)
[12:27:09]* cmoates has joined #aegir
[12:39:19]* zombiebeard has quit (Quit: zombiebeard)
[12:56:59]* rominronin has joined #aegir
[13:02:48]* rominronin has quit (Ping timeout: 276 seconds)
[14:10:03]* Egyptian[Home] has quit (Quit: Leaving.)
[14:25:14]* hefring has joined #aegir
[14:58:05]* rominronin has joined #aegir
[15:03:04]* rominronin has quit (Ping timeout: 240 seconds)
[16:07:27]* rominronin has joined #aegir
[16:09:55]* esolitos has joined #aegir
[16:31:47]* orangey has quit (Ping timeout: 260 seconds)
[16:34:23]* orangey has joined #aegir
[16:35:12]* boshtian has joined #aegir
[16:48:41]* lavamind has quit (Ping timeout: 244 seconds)
[16:55:24]* ybabel has joined #aegir
[16:55:41]* ybabel has quit (Client Quit)
[17:08:04]* lavamind has joined #aegir
[17:10:51]* ybabel has joined #aegir
[17:58:16]* jonpugh has quit (Ping timeout: 276 seconds)
[17:58:18]* bgm has quit (Ping timeout: 276 seconds)
[17:58:46]* moshe_fishing has quit (Ping timeout: 276 seconds)
[17:58:46]* spyd has quit (Ping timeout: 276 seconds)
[17:59:30]* bgm has joined #aegir
[17:59:31]* bgm has quit (Changing host)
[17:59:31]* bgm has joined #aegir
[17:59:31]* spyd has joined #aegir
[18:07:16]* moshe_fishing has joined #aegir
[18:08:38]* jonpugh has joined #aegir
[18:46:08]* gandhiano has joined #aegir
[20:53:04]* Egyptian[Home] has joined #aegir
[21:15:14]* Egyptian[Home] has quit (Quit: Leaving.)
[21:25:10]* noecc has joined #aegir
[21:28:17]* zombiebeard has joined #aegir
[21:59:24]* netrunner has joined #aegir
[22:13:13]* zombiebeard has quit (Quit: zombiebeard)
[22:26:35]* mstenta has joined #aegir
[23:15:42]* hosttor has quit (Remote host closed the connection)
[23:40:27]* gandhiano has quit (Ping timeout: 276 seconds)
[23:56:09]* zombiebeard has joined #aegir
[00:12:07]* Yaazkal has joined #aegir
[00:34:45]* esolitos has quit (Quit: esolitos)
[00:39:42]* netrunner has quit (Ping timeout: 250 seconds)
[00:41:18]* rominronin has quit (Remote host closed the connection)
[00:54:33]* boshtian has quit (Ping timeout: 276 seconds)
[00:59:21]* hestenet has joined #aegir
[01:26:28]* nulp_ is now known as nulp
[01:41:53]* rominronin has joined #aegir
[01:47:29]* rominronin has quit (Ping timeout: 260 seconds)
[02:06:19]* gandhiano has joined #aegir
[02:34:30]* freiheit has joined #aegir
[02:41:09]* orangey has quit (Ping timeout: 260 seconds)
[02:43:53]* orangey has joined #aegir
[02:44:35]* gandhiano has quit (Ping timeout: 276 seconds)
[03:25:15]<gboudrias>colan: Great job on the SaaS stuff, looks like it's about ready for an alpha release :)
[03:26:01]<gboudrias>colan: aegir web services doesn't seem to have any permissions though?
[03:28:26]<colan>gboudrias: thanks! yeah, there are 2 perm required. i've got that in my internal docs. wasn't sure if those should be enabled automatically by the module, or put in the install instructions. thoughts?
[03:28:45]<gboudrias>colan: Yeah they should be enabled automatically imo
[03:29:16]<gboudrias>colan: That was we can simply turn on the module and start using it (with the Services API key caveat which is good I think)
[03:29:33]<colan>gboudrias: i was a bit worried about security, but i'll agree as i've already got a random key set-up on install.
[03:30:11]<colan>gboudrias: ok, i'll add the perms to hook_install.
[03:30:30]<gboudrias>cool
[03:30:37]<gboudrias>(I'm still testing everything)
[03:31:29]<colan>gboudrias: would you want to create a new branch (e.g. 7.x-3.x to match aegir), or just put stuff in the existing 1.x?
[03:32:08]<colan>great, re testing. there's still more to do, but yeah, the bulk of that is there. still need to move more stuff from your hook to mine though.
[03:32:11]<gboudrias>colan: Not sure, there isn't really a protocol, but I think the change is big enough to warrant a new branch even if it's a dev release
[03:32:46]<gboudrias>So yeah new branch is better I think
[03:32:56]<colan>gboudrias: what do you think about 3.x to match aegir?
[03:33:06]<gboudrias>colan: Yeah good idea
[03:33:10]<colan>...and Services :)
[03:34:12]<gboudrias>colan: Do you remember which 2 permissions need to be enabled?
[03:34:50]<colan>Under Aegir Services API, check Get Site.
[03:34:50]<colan>Under Node, check Task: Create new content.
[03:34:59]* hestenet_ has joined #aegir
[03:35:15]<colan>gboudrias: ^^^
[03:35:33]<gboudrias>colan: Makes sense, thanks
[03:36:34]<colan>gboudrias: should i just rename my branch to 3.x?
[03:36:49]<gboudrias>colan: Yep :)
[03:37:09]* hestenet has quit (Ping timeout: 260 seconds)
[03:45:06]<gboudrias>colan: Would you mind pasting an example of how you test the API key and/or the cloning?
[03:45:10]<gboudrias>We should add it to the doc
[03:46:57]<colan>gboudrias: yeah, that's coming. haven't got to the doc yet.
[03:56:46]<gboudrias>colan: I'm adding server_settings to the endpoint for the application/x-www-form-urlencoded parser (required for CURL testing afaict)
[03:56:59]<gboudrias>colan: I'll wait for the branch renaming to push stuff
[03:58:10]* netrunner has joined #aegir
[04:01:57]<colan>gboudrias: you should be able to push to 7.x-3.x now.
[04:02:26]<gboudrias>colan: thanks!
[04:15:06]* freiheit has left #aegir ()
[04:15:33]<colan>alpha1 published: https://www.drupal.org/node/2718251
[04:15:34]<hefring>https://www.drupal.org/node/2718251 => hosting_services 7.x-3.0-alpha1 => 0 comments, 1 IRC mention
[04:16:15]<gboudrias>colan: Awesome!
[04:16:44]<gboudrias>colan: From the code doc I'm guessing you're testing in PHP?
[04:18:21]<gboudrias>Thanks so much for doing all of this btw
[04:18:41]<colan>gboudrias: you mean the client? actually just using postman so far.
[04:18:58]<gboudrias>oh cool
[04:19:54]<colan>happy to work on this stuff so that we're not all doing our own custom hacking.
[04:20:11]<gboudrias>heheh
[04:20:31]<colan>bgm: ^^^^
[04:33:41]* loganfarr has joined #aegir
[04:34:05]<loganfarr>Where can I find the latest Aegir version to put into my upgrade.sh script?
[04:36:45]<gboudrias>loganfarr: It's 3.4 : https://www.drupal.org/project/hostmaster
[04:38:13]<gboudrias>loganfarr: if you mean how to follow releases you can subscribe to the feed on the releases page, eg: https://www.drupal.org/node/195997/release/feed?api_version[0]=103
[04:38:14]<hefring>https://www.drupal.org/node/195997 => Hostmaster (Aegir) => 0 comments, 1 IRC mention
[04:38:32]<gboudrias>(taken at the bottom of https://www.drupal.org/node/195997/release?api_version[]=103)
[04:38:32]<hefring>https://www.drupal.org/node/195997 => Hostmaster (Aegir) => 0 comments, 2 IRC mentions
[04:39:33]<loganfarr>Thank you!
[04:43:07]* rominronin has joined #aegir
[04:47:54]* rominronin has quit (Ping timeout: 244 seconds)
[04:48:21]* loganfarr has quit (Quit: Page closed)
[04:50:02]* orangey has quit (Ping timeout: 276 seconds)
[04:50:43]* orangey has joined #aegir
[04:56:37]* ybabel has quit (Quit: ybabel)
[05:32:42]* noecc has quit (Remote host closed the connection)
[05:42:19]* orangey has quit (*.net *.split)
[05:42:20]* hestenet_ has quit (*.net *.split)
[05:42:21]* spyd has quit (*.net *.split)
[05:42:21]* cdracars has quit (*.net *.split)
[05:42:23]* HaloFX has quit (*.net *.split)
[05:42:27]* anto has quit (*.net *.split)
[05:42:27]* michiel has quit (*.net *.split)
[05:44:58]* gandhiano has joined #aegir
[05:51:23]* orangey has joined #aegir
[05:51:23]* hestenet_ has joined #aegir
[05:51:23]* spyd has joined #aegir
[05:51:23]* cdracars has joined #aegir
[05:51:23]* HaloFX has joined #aegir
[05:51:24]* michiel has joined #aegir
[05:51:25]* anto has joined #aegir
[06:26:20]* ceaucari has joined #aegir
[06:44:22]* rominronin has joined #aegir
[06:45:23]* hestenet_ has quit (Remote host closed the connection)
[06:49:38]* rominronin has quit (Ping timeout: 276 seconds)
[07:06:00]* colan has quit (Remote host closed the connection)
[07:06:55]* colan has joined #aegir
[08:03:35]* hefring has joined #aegir
[08:11:02]* Egyptian[Home] has joined #aegir
[08:11:30]* gandhiano has joined #aegir
[08:11:52]* Fuzzy76 has quit (Ping timeout: 264 seconds)
[08:13:04]* Fuzzy76 has joined #aegir
[08:22:24]* Egyptian[Home] has quit (Ping timeout: 260 seconds)
[08:26:31]* ceaucari has quit (Quit: Textual IRC Client: www.textualapp.com)
[08:27:06]<colan>i just tried hostmaster-migrate for the first time to upgrade drupal core, and it seems to runs without problems, but (1) the status page still lists the old version of core, and (2) the site & platform verify tasks are stuck in "This task has not been processed yet" so it doesn't look like they're running.
[08:28:48]<colan>anyone know what's wrong?
[08:30:07]* ceaucari has joined #aegir
[08:31:26]<gboudrias>colan: I don't know about the old version of core, but did you check that your queue daemon has successfully restarted?
[08:31:35]<gboudrias>sudo service hosting-queued status
[08:31:56]<gboudrias>It usually crashes :p
[08:33:16]* ceaucari has quit (Max SendQ exceeded)
[08:34:10]* ceaucari has joined #aegir
[08:34:12]<colan>"hosting-queued is not running" <--- thanks.
[08:34:19]* hestenet has joined #aegir
[08:34:22]<colan>gboudrias: is there an issue for that?
[08:35:31]<gboudrias>colan: I mean, there are a lot of support requests. I'm hoping for progress on this personally: https://www.drupal.org/node/2672530
[08:35:32]<hefring>https://www.drupal.org/node/2672530 => Adopt Python queue daemon replacement [#2672530] => 2 comments, 1 IRC mention
[08:37:18]* ceaucari has quit (Max SendQ exceeded)
[08:37:59]* ceaucari has joined #aegir
[08:41:29]<colan>so is this not the method for dealing with drupal core security updates? looks like everything is okay now, except it didn't do the one thing i wanted.
[08:42:09]<colan>core is still 7.42, not 7.43.
[08:44:05]<gboudrias>colan: You mean for the core upgrade? I think there's a bug request, but we also want to start doing minor releases for it
[08:44:11]<gboudrias>bug report*
[08:45:16]* rominronin has joined #aegir
[08:46:32]<gboudrias>I can't find the issue though
[08:47:02]<gboudrias>Except this I mean: https://www.drupal.org/node/2698027
[08:47:03]<hefring>https://www.drupal.org/node/2698027 => Minor release to update core? [#2698027] => 2 comments, 2 IRC mentions
[08:51:00]* rominronin has quit (Ping timeout: 276 seconds)
[08:53:48]* gandhiano has quit (Ping timeout: 276 seconds)
[09:03:32]* netrunner has quit (Ping timeout: 276 seconds)
[09:26:37]* hestenet has quit (Remote host closed the connection)
[09:46:44]* Egyptian[Home] has joined #aegir
[09:49:32]* netrunner has joined #aegir